Given Input Data is 40, 513, 559, 291
Make a list of Prime Factors of all the given numbers initially
Prime Factorization of 40 is 2 x 2 x 2 x 5
Prime Factorization of 513 is 3 x 3 x 3 x 19
Prime Factorization of 559 is 13 x 43
Prime Factorization of 291 is 3 x 97
The above numbers do not have any common prime factor. So GCD is 1
